Compliance with the stormwater <br />development standards for pre-treatment and any detention requirements will be <br />confirmed during the development permit process. <br /> <br />Streets <br />The southern boundary of the subject property abuts County Farm Road, which is <br />classified as a Major Collector street within City limits. The roadway is not improved to <br />urban standards, as it lacks curbs, gutters, and sidewalks, but it currently has a 36-foot <br />wide paved surface abutting the subject property. Roadway improvements will be <br />addressed as part of a subsequent development permit. <br /> <br />Solid Waste <br />Collection service is provided by private firms. Regional disposal sites and the Short <br />Mountain Landfill are operated by Lane County. <br /> <br />Water & Electric <br />Eugene Water and Electric Board (EWEB) services are available to serve the subject <br />property. Referral comments from EWEB staff state no objections to the proposed <br />annexation and include contact information for obtaining additional service information. <br /> <br />Public Safety <br />Police protection can be extended to this site upon annexation consistent with service <br />provision through the City. Fire protection services and ambulance services are currently <br />provided to the subject property by the City of Eugene. Emergency medical services are <br />currently provided on a regional basis by the cities of Eugene and Springfield to central <br />Lane County and will continue in the same manner upon annexation. <br /> <br />Parks and Recreation <br />A minimum level of park service can be provided to the proposal area as prescribed in <br />the Metro Plan. Armitage Park is located approximately 1,580 feet to the west. <br /> <br />Planning and Development Services <br />Planning and building permit services are provided for all properties located within the <br />urban growth boundary by the City of Eugene.
